London: Kegan Paul, Trench, Trubner & Co., Inc.. Good/No Jacket. 1921. Soft cover. Being the Life and Teaching of Gautama Prince of India and Founder of Buddhism (As told in verse by an Indian Buddhist). Red leather binding with gilt titling. Gilt top edge. Slight to moderate wear/rubbing/soiling to covers and spine. Contents clean and tight. A good solid reading copy. .
